Megan Rapinoe and Sue Bird: relationship, timeline, and verified details

Megan Rapinoe and Sue Bird are an American power couple known for intersecting soccer and basketball excellence, shared activism, and a long-term partnership publicly recognized since the late 2010s. This explainer compiles verified milestones, public statements, and context for their relationship and individual careers, prioritizing durable facts over speculation. Below, we outline their paths to prominence, key joint moments, and how they balance public life with privacy.

Individual careers and public profiles

Megan Rapinoe co-captained the United States women’s national soccer team, won the 2019 FIFA World Cup, and is widely recognized for her activism on gender pay equity, LGBTQ+ rights, and racial justice. Sue Bird won multiple NCAA titles at UConn, then a historic WNBA career with the Seattle Storm, capturing four WNBA championships before retirement, and later worked as an executive and broadcaster. Both are regarded as all-time greats who used their platforms to advance equity in sports.

Rapinoe: profile and impact

  • Position: Midfielder/forward; known for leadership, technical skill, and set-piece delivery.
  • Activism: Vocal advocacy for equal pay, outlined in the USWNT’s lawsuit and public campaigns.
  • Major honors: 2019 World Cup champion, multiple FIFA and NWSL Player of the Year awards.

Bird: profile and impact

  • Position: Point guard; clutch performer and defensive leader in the WNBA.
  • Legacy: Four WNBA championships, Olympic gold medals, and pioneering playmaking.
  • Post-playing roles: Front office and media work, contributing to women’s basketball growth.

Relationship timeline and public acknowledgment

Their relationship became a subject of public interest in the late 2010s, notably around the 2018 midterm election cycle when both were vocal about social issues. While they have largely guarded private moments, they have appeared together at high-profile events and issued joint statements on matters of shared values. The following table outlines key publicly documented milestones related to their visibility as a couple.

Date or PeriodEventWhy it matters
2018–2019Increased joint appearances and social media visibilityCoincided with midterm elections and national conversations on equality
2019Rapinoe’s World Cup victory and Bird’s championship season contextBoth captured titles in their sports within the same calendar year, amplifying their shared platform
2020–2021Public advocacy around voting, racial justice, and LGBTQ+ supportReflected alignment on using influence for civic engagement
2022–2023Bird’s front‑office and media roles; Rapinoe’s continued activism and club playDemonstrated sustained engagement in sport beyond playing careers

Statements and boundaries

When discussing their relationship, both have emphasized normalizing love across identities while maintaining boundaries. They have declined intrusive questions in interviews, advocating for privacy regarding personal matters. Public comments from each have focused on shared principles—equality, representation, and using sport for social good—rather than personal exposition.

Cultural significance and media framing

As high-profile women athletes from different sports, Rapinoe and Bird represent a broader shift toward recognizing diverse relationships in sports. Media coverage has often highlighted their visibility as LGBTQ+ women in athletics, while they have consistently redirected attention to policy changes and opportunities for others. Their influence is measurable in conversations around pay equity, voting access, and inclusive representation.

Impact and legacy

Together, they illustrate how athletes can build power beyond statistics, shaping cultural norms and policy discussions. While their individual accolades are well documented, their joint impact is reflected in amplified advocacy, mentorship, and normalized representation for future generations. Their approach to privacy paired with purposeful activism offers a model for leveraging fame responsibly.
